I worship at the television altar
Smallville: Brian Peterson talks to TVGuide.com
tariel22 From: tariel22 Date: April 16th, 2010 12:30 am (UTC) (Link)
I still can't believe he said that, Carol! Redemption?! What about Oliver?! What about Chloe?!

I did find the rest hopeful, though. Not that I really trust anything BP ever says.
